Early Career and Rise to Prominence
Oscar's football journey began in his native Brazil, where he honed his skills and showcased his talent from a young age. He started his youth career with União Barbarense before moving to São Paulo FC in 2004. It was here that Oscar began to make a name for himself, impressing coaches and scouts with his technical ability and vision on the field. During his time in the youth ranks, Oscar stood out for his exceptional ball control, dribbling skills, and ability to create scoring opportunities for his teammates. His performances earned him a spot in the senior team, where he continued to develop and mature as a player.
In 2008, Oscar made his professional debut for São Paulo FC, marking the beginning of his senior career. Despite his young age, he quickly adapted to the demands of professional football and began to showcase his potential on a bigger stage. Oscar's versatility allowed him to play in various midfield positions, further enhancing his value to the team. He demonstrated his ability to dictate the tempo of the game, make incisive passes, and contribute defensively when needed. As he gained more experience, Oscar's confidence grew, and he became an integral part of São Paulo FC's squad.
Oscar's performances for São Paulo FC did not go unnoticed, and it wasn't long before he attracted the attention of other clubs, both domestically and internationally. In 2010, he made a move to Internacional, another prominent Brazilian club, where he continued his development and further solidified his reputation as one of the most promising young talents in Brazilian football. At Internacional, Oscar continued to shine, displaying his creativity, technical skills, and goal-scoring ability. He became a key player for the team, helping them compete for titles and achieve success in both domestic and international competitions. His contributions to Internacional further enhanced his profile and paved the way for his eventual move to Europe.
Chelsea: Conquering Europe
In 2012, Oscar made a significant move to English Premier League side Chelsea. This transfer marked a pivotal moment in his career, as he stepped onto the European stage to showcase his talent. At Chelsea, Oscar joined a squad filled with world-class players and under the guidance of experienced coaches, he quickly adapted to the English game and became an integral part of the team. His arrival brought a new dimension to Chelsea's midfield, adding creativity, flair, and goal-scoring ability.
Oscar's time at Chelsea was marked by several memorable moments and achievements. He played a crucial role in helping the team win the Premier League title in the 2014-2015 season, contributing with important goals and assists. His performances in the Champions League were also noteworthy, as he demonstrated his ability to compete against the best teams in Europe. Oscar's work rate, tactical awareness, and versatility made him a valuable asset to Chelsea, and he quickly became a fan favorite at Stamford Bridge.
During his time at Chelsea, Oscar had the opportunity to work with some of the best managers in the world, including Roberto Di Matteo, Rafael BenÃtez, and José Mourinho. Each manager brought their own tactical approach and style of play, and Oscar was able to adapt and thrive under their guidance. He learned valuable lessons about the tactical aspects of the game, the importance of teamwork, and the need for consistency in performance. These experiences helped him develop into a more complete and well-rounded player.
Shanghai SIPG: A New Chapter
In 2017, Oscar made a surprising move to Chinese Super League side Shanghai SIPG. This transfer raised eyebrows among football fans and pundits, as it meant leaving one of the top leagues in the world to play in a relatively less competitive environment. However, Oscar's decision was motivated by a desire for a new challenge and the opportunity to play a more prominent role in a team. At Shanghai SIPG, he joined a squad with high ambitions and the resources to compete for titles. The move also came with a lucrative financial package, making him one of the highest-paid players in the world.
Oscar's arrival at Shanghai SIPG brought excitement and anticipation to the club and its fans. He was expected to be the star player, the creative spark that would lead the team to success. And he did not disappoint. Oscar quickly established himself as a key player for Shanghai SIPG, showcasing his skills, vision, and goal-scoring ability. He formed a strong partnership with his teammates, and together they achieved significant success in the Chinese Super League and other competitions. Oscar's contributions helped Shanghai SIPG win their first-ever Chinese Super League title in 2018, marking a historic moment for the club.
International Career: Representing Brazil
Oscar has also been a prominent figure in the Brazilian national team, representing his country at various levels. He made his debut for the senior team in 2011 and has since become a regular member of the squad. Oscar has participated in major tournaments such as the FIFA World Cup and the Copa América, where he has showcased his talent and contributed to Brazil's success. His performances for the national team have further solidified his reputation as one of the top Brazilian players of his generation.
One of the highlights of Oscar's international career was his participation in the 2014 FIFA World Cup, which was held in Brazil. Playing on home soil, Oscar and his teammates carried the hopes of a nation eager to see their team lift the trophy. While Brazil did not ultimately win the tournament, Oscar played a significant role, showcasing his skills and creating memorable moments for the fans. He scored a memorable goal against Croatia in the opening match, helping Brazil secure a crucial victory.
Throughout his international career, Oscar has had the opportunity to play alongside some of the greatest Brazilian players of all time, including Neymar, Thiago Silva, and David Luiz. These experiences have been invaluable in his development as a player, as he has learned from their experience, leadership, and professionalism. Oscar has also represented Brazil in youth tournaments, winning the FIFA U-20 World Cup in 2011. His success at the youth level foreshadowed his potential and paved the way for his eventual success in the senior team.
Style of Play and Key Attributes
Oscar is known for his versatility, technical ability, and playmaking skills. He can play in various midfield positions, including attacking midfielder, central midfielder, and winger. His ability to adapt to different roles makes him a valuable asset to any team. Oscar is also known for his excellent vision, passing range, and ability to create scoring opportunities for his teammates. He has a knack for delivering pinpoint crosses and through balls that unlock defenses and set up goals.
In addition to his playmaking skills, Oscar is also a capable goal scorer. He has a powerful shot from distance and is often dangerous from set-pieces. His ability to score goals from midfield adds another dimension to his game and makes him a threat to opposing defenses. Oscar is also known for his work rate and defensive contribution. He is willing to track back and help his team defend, making him a complete midfielder who can contribute in all phases of the game.
